The Future of Skylines: Skyscrapers From Asteroids

The Future of Skylines: Skyscrapers From Asteroids

Skyscrapers from asteroids are a visionary concept that involves utilizing materials from asteroids to construct towering structures on Earth. Asteroids are rich in various metals and minerals, including iron, nickel, silicon, and aluminum, which are essential components for skyscraper construction.

The primary benefit of using asteroid materials is their abundance and accessibility. Asteroids are numerous in our solar system, and their material composition is well-suited for construction purposes. Furthermore, extracting resources from asteroids eliminates the environmental impact associated with terrestrial mining.

Building skyscrapers from asteroids presents numerous challenges, including the development of cost-effective extraction and transportation methods. However, the potential benefits, such as the conservation of Earth’s resources and the creation of sustainable building materials, make this concept a promising area of research and development.

1. Material composition

1. Material Composition, Skyscraper

The material composition of asteroids makes them a promising source of raw materials for constructing skyscrapers on Earth. Asteroids are rich in various metals and minerals, including iron, nickel, silicon, and aluminum, which are essential components for skyscraper construction.

  • Structural components: Iron and steel are the primary structural components of skyscrapers, providing strength and durability. Asteroids contain abundant iron, which can be extracted and processed to create these structural elements.
  • Reinforcement and cladding: Nickel and silicon are used in alloys to reinforce steel and create corrosion-resistant cladding for skyscrapers. Asteroids contain significant amounts of these elements, providing the necessary materials for these applications.
  • Electrical wiring and components: Aluminum is a lightweight and highly conductive metal used in electrical wiring and components in skyscrapers. Asteroids contain abundant aluminum, which can be extracted and processed to meet these needs.
  • Interior finishes and fixtures: Silicon and aluminum are also used in various interior finishes and fixtures, such as glass, ceramics, and composite materials. Asteroids provide a sustainable source of these materials, reducing the need for terrestrial mining.

In conclusion, the material composition of asteroids aligns well with the requirements for skyscraper construction. The abundance of essential metals and minerals in asteroids makes them a viable source for sustainable and cost-effective construction materials, supporting the feasibility of skyscrapers from asteroids.

6. Technological advancements

6. Technological Advancements, Skyscraper

The concept of “skyscraper from asteroid” hinges critically on technological advancements, particularly in space exploration and construction techniques. These advancements are essential for overcoming the unique challenges posed by this concept and transforming it into a feasible reality.

Firstly, space exploration technologies play a vital role in accessing and extracting materials from asteroids. Advanced spacecraft and robotic systems are needed to navigate the vast distances of space, land on asteroids, and extract the necessary materials efficiently. These technologies must be capable of operating autonomously in extreme conditions, such as microgravity and radiation exposure.

Secondly, innovative construction techniques are crucial for assembling and erecting skyscrapers using asteroid materials. Traditional construction methods are not directly applicable in space, and new approaches must be developed to account for the unique properties of asteroid materials and the challenges of working in a zero-gravity environment. These techniques may involve the use of modular construction, 3D printing, and advanced robotics.

Real-life examples of technological advancements in space exploration and construction techniques that support the concept of “skyscraper from asteroid” include:

  • The development of autonomous spacecraft and robotic systems for asteroid exploration and sample return missions.
  • Advancements in 3D printing technologies for rapid and efficient construction in space.
  • The use of modular construction techniques to assemble complex structures in space, such as the International Space Station.
